The Evolution of Armstrong: From Hot Five to Stardust
This chapter explores the transformative journey of Louis Armstrong's music career during the 1930s and 1940s, highlighting his shift from early ensembles to big band music. It emphasizes his groundbreaking interpretation of 'Stardust' and his role as the first black pop star in shaping 20th-century pop music.
